2. Rod Power
Rod power refers to the amount of force required to bend the rod. It is typically rated as ultra-light, light, medium-light, medium, medium-heavy, heavy, or extra-heavy. The appropriate power rating depends on the size and weight of the lures you'll be using and the size of the fish you'll be targeting.
- Ultra-Light and Light: These rods are best suited for small lures and light line. They are ideal for panfish, trout, and other small species.
- Medium-Light and Medium: These rods offer a good balance of sensitivity and power. They are versatile enough for a variety of species and techniques.
- Medium-Heavy and Heavy: These rods are designed for larger lures and heavier line. They are ideal for bass, pike, and other larger species.
- Extra-Heavy: These rods are the most powerful and are used for targeting very large fish, such as muskie or catfish.
When selecting the power of your 13 fishing pole, consider the typical size of the fish you'll be targeting and the weight of the lures you'll be using. If you're unsure, it's often best to err on the side of a slightly heavier power rating.
3. Rod Action
Rod action refers to how much of the rod bends when pressure is applied to the tip. It is typically rated as slow, moderate, fast, or extra-fast. The appropriate action depends on the type of lures you'll be using and the type of fishing you'll be doing.
- Slow Action: Slow action rods bend throughout the entire length of the rod. They are best suited for fishing with live bait or for techniques that require a lot of forgiveness, such as crankbait fishing.
- Moderate Action: Moderate action rods bend primarily in the middle of the rod. They offer a good balance of sensitivity and power and are versatile enough for a variety of techniques.
- Fast Action: Fast action rods bend primarily in the tip of the rod. They are best suited for techniques that require a lot of sensitivity and quick hooksets, such as jigging or worm fishing.
- Extra-Fast Action: Extra-fast action rods bend only in the very tip of the rod. They offer the most sensitivity and are ideal for detecting subtle strikes.
Consider the type of lures you'll be using and the type of fishing you'll be doing when selecting the action of your 13 fishing pole. If you're unsure, a moderate action rod is a good choice for all-around versatility.
4. Rod Length
Rod length also plays a crucial role in performance. Longer rods generally cast further, while shorter rods offer more control and are better suited for close-quarters fishing.
- 6-Foot to 6-Foot 6-Inch: These rods are ideal for fishing in tight spaces, such as streams or heavily wooded areas. They offer excellent control and are easy to maneuver.
- 6-Foot 6-Inch to 7-Foot: These rods are versatile enough for a variety of fishing situations. They offer a good balance of casting distance and control.
- 7-Foot to 7-Foot 6-Inch: These rods are ideal for casting long distances. They are often used for fishing in open water or for techniques that require long casts.
- 7-Foot 6-Inch and Longer: These rods are designed for specialized techniques, such as surf fishing or muskie fishing. They offer maximum casting distance and power.
Consider the type of fishing you'll be doing and the size of the water you'll be fishing in when selecting the length of your 13 fishing pole.
5. Material and Construction
The material and construction of a 13 fishing pole can significantly impact its sensitivity, power, and durability. Most rods are made from either fiberglass, graphite, or a combination of both.
- Fiberglass: Fiberglass rods are durable and affordable. They are a good choice for beginners or for anglers who are tough on their equipment.
- Graphite: Graphite rods are more sensitive and lighter than fiberglass rods. They are a good choice for anglers who prioritize sensitivity and performance.
- Composite: Composite rods combine the best features of both fiberglass and graphite. They offer a good balance of sensitivity, power, and durability.
